MELBOURNE: Singapore Telecommunications said on Monday it was assessing the potential cost of a massive cybersecurity breach at its Optus arm, Australia's second-largest telco, 12 days ago.
Last week, an unidentified person posted online that they had released personal details of 10,000 Optus customers. Optus on Monday said it had appointed Deloitte to run an independent external review of the cyberattack. Optus also confirmed on Monday that personal information and at least one valid form of identification of about 1.2 million customers was compromised.
